B12 Deficiency: Understanding the Recovery Process
Vitamin B12, also known as cobalamin, is a crucial water-soluble vitamin essential for producing red blood cells, maintaining nerve health, and synthesizing DNA. When levels drop, symptoms can range from fatigue and weakness to more serious neurological issues like tingling, balance problems, and memory loss. The good news is that with proper treatment, recovery is very possible, but the timeline can differ dramatically from person to person.
Factors Influencing Your Recovery Speed
Several key factors determine the pace at which your B12 levels will be restored and symptoms alleviated. It's not a one-size-fits-all process and hinges on your unique health profile.
- Severity of Deficiency: Mild deficiencies resolve much faster than severe ones, which can take six months to a year for symptoms to fully subside.
- Cause of Deficiency: The reason for your low B12 is a primary driver of your recovery path. For example, a dietary deficiency in a vegan may be corrected with oral supplements, while pernicious anemia (an autoimmune condition where the body cannot absorb B12 from food) requires lifelong treatment.
- Treatment Method: The mode of supplementation plays a significant role in how quickly your body replenishes its stores.
- Adherence to Treatment: Consistency is paramount. Failing to stick to the prescribed regimen can significantly delay recovery.
- Age and Overall Health: Older adults and individuals with underlying health conditions, such as gastrointestinal disorders, may experience a slower response to treatment.
Comparison of B12 Treatment Methods
The choice between oral supplements and injections often depends on the severity of the deficiency and the underlying cause. While injections offer a rapid, high-absorption method, high-dose oral supplements have also proven effective for many people.
| Feature | B12 Injections | High-Dose Oral Supplements | Natural Food Sources |
|---|---|---|---|
| Absorption | Near 100%, directly into bloodstream. | Varies, typically 1-5% due to passive diffusion. | Variable and often low, depends on intrinsic factor and digestion. |
| Onset of Effects | 24–72 hours for initial energy boost. | Typically takes longer for noticeable energy improvements. | Gradual, over months of consistent intake. |
| Best For | Severe deficiency, pernicious anemia, malabsorption issues. | Mild to moderate deficiency, or long-term maintenance. | Long-term maintenance after initial levels are restored. |
| Frequency | Determined by healthcare provider. | Determined by healthcare provider. | Daily consumption of B12-rich foods. |
| Convenience | Requires a visit to a healthcare provider for administration. | Easily purchased and taken at home daily. | Requires consistent meal planning and preparation. |
Recovery Timeline: What to Expect
While the exact timeline is individual, there are general stages of recovery that most patients experience once treatment begins.
- Days 1–7: Initial Response. For those receiving injections, improvements in fatigue and mood can be felt within 24 to 72 hours. The body starts replenishing its depleted red blood cell stores, leading to an initial energy lift. Some may feel more tired or experience other temporary side effects as their body adjusts.
- Week 2–4: Noticeable Improvements. Injections and high-dose oral supplements begin to show significant results. Fatigue and weakness symptoms continue to decrease, and many people report better sleep quality and mental clarity.
- Months 1–3: Deeper Healing. This is a critical period for addressing neurological symptoms. Tingling and numbness may begin to fade, and memory and concentration can improve. Full nerve repair can take time and patience, as this process is slower than replenishing blood cell stores.
- Months 3–6 and Beyond: Long-Term Recovery. For those with severe deficiencies or pernicious anemia, this period focuses on sustained recovery. Long-term neurological symptoms may continue to improve, though some pre-existing nerve damage may be irreversible. Your healthcare provider will establish a long-term maintenance plan, which may involve regular injections or continued oral supplements.
Supporting Your Recovery with a Nutrition Diet
Beyond supplements and injections, a proper nutrition diet is foundational for maintaining healthy B12 levels, especially after the initial deficiency has been corrected. Vitamin B12 is naturally found in animal-based products.
- Meat and Poultry: Beef, liver, and chicken are excellent sources.
- Fish and Seafood: Clams, salmon, tuna, and oysters offer a rich supply of B12.
- Dairy Products: Milk, yogurt, and cheese are good options for those who consume dairy.
- Eggs: A simple yet effective source of B12.
- Fortified Foods: For vegans, vegetarians, and older adults with absorption issues, fortified foods like breakfast cereals, nutritional yeast, and some plant-based milks are crucial.
It is vital to consult with a doctor or registered dietitian to create a personalized nutrition plan, especially if you have an underlying absorption disorder. They can ensure you are getting enough B12 without relying solely on supplements.
